With time winding down in Tuesday’s state girls basketball Class 4A quarterfinal, the Los Alamos Hilltoppers had three chances to tie the score with the St. Pius X Sartans.

But those three late possessions for Los Alamos proved fruitless, and St. Pius held on for a 40-36 victory at University Arena in Albuquerque.

With just a bucket separating the two teams, the sixth-seeded Hilltoppers turned the ball over, shot an ill-advised 3-pointer, and got trapped in the deep right corner by the Sartan defense.

Tuesday’s loss ended a very good season for the Hilltoppers, in which they posted 20 wins. It was their second loss this season to St. Pius, the three seed in this year’s postseason – the Sartans defeated Los Alamos at Griffith Gymnasium a month earlier by a similar score.

Los Alamos led for most of the first half, hanging on to a 14-13 in an offensively slow first half.

St. Pius (22-5) tried working the ball inside for much of the first half, but Los Alamos’ defense, which was smaller inside than the Sartans’ offense, held its ground and allowed only 3 field goals inside before the break.

In the third quarter, however, the Sartans were able to get penetration from their guards and that opened up some shooting opportunities. With their fast second half start, the Sartans quickly built up an 8-point lead before the Hilltoppers bounced back.

Sofia Trujillo hit two big buckets on back-to-back possessions for the Hilltoppers as they fought back. Trujillo and GG Romero had 3-pointers in the quarter to help their team to knot the score at 28-28 heading into the final frame.

St. Pius again got some penetration in the fourth quarter to take the lead before Los Alamos’ late chances to tie the score. St. Pius’ Catalina Anaya canned two pressure free throws with just seconds left to seal the win.

Tuesday’s game was the finale in the careers of six Hilltopper seniors: Michelle Macias, MacKenzie Echave, Kaitlyn Velarde, Catherine Trujillo, Carley Holland and Tara McDonald. Holland and McDonald, who start for Los Alamos, had 8 points and 6 points in the game, and McDonald had 6 rebounds.

Romero was the leading scorer for the Hilltoppers with 11 points, while Trujillo added 7. Point guard Marisol Valdez had 11 for St. Pius.
